What does a daily standup actually cost?
For an eight-person team meeting 15 minutes a day, five days a week, at a fully loaded rate of $120 an hour, a daily standup costs roughly $84,640 a year once you count the time it takes to get back into deep work. About $63,480 of that is recoverable, or 66 engineer-days. The rest comes back as async coordination, because killing the meeting does not hand back all of the time.
That figure assumes 46 working weeks rather than 52, and 8 minutes of refocus per person rather than the 23 minutes measured for unplanned interruptions. Change any assumption below to get your own number.
